Animal Care and Science T Level at a Glance

 

From 2023 the T Level in Agriculture, Environment and Animal Care will be available at Sparsholt College, with Specialist Pathways available in Agriculture, Land Management and Production. 

The T Level in Animal Care provides a unique opportunity to undertake a qualification that is supplemented by experiences within the industry. You will undertake core content such as Sustainability, Business, Communication, Health and Safety and Finance; all important theory that underpins knowledge and understanding of the wider Agricultural sector. Following this, occupational specialism units will allow you to specialise in Animal Care/Management or Animal Science. The Animal Management pathway focuses on the skills and knowledge needed for the practical Husbandry, Nutrition and Welfare of animals in a range of settings, including domestic pets, zoo animals, farm animals, wildlife centres and other collections.  The Animal Science pathway leads students into careers which are underpinned by Research Skills and scientific knowledge such as Animal Nutrition, Diseases and Welfare, Genetic Research and teaches Biological Principals to prepare for work or University level courses.
